Sea Hearts  by Margo Lanagan

Allen & Unwin, $19.99 pb, 343 pp, 9781742375052

ABR receives a commission on items purchased through this link. All ABR reviews are fully independent.

Sea Hearts takes place in an intensely wrought setting, both unnerving and thrilling – in propinquity to our world, yet enchantingly different. We journey, with a series of intriguing characters, through brutal landscapes where the wind is ‘swiping like a cat’s paw at a mousehole’.
